“I spent my life folded between the pages of books.In the absence of human relationships I formed bonds with paper characters. I lived love and loss through stories threaded in history; I experienced adolescence by association. My world is one interwoven web of words, stringing limb to limb, bone to sinew, thoughts and images all together. I am a being comprised of letters, a character created by sentences, a figment of imagination formed through fiction.”

― Tahereh Mafi, Shatter Me

About Our Reviews:





We put only our honest opinion in our reviews. We try to say what we liked and what we didn’t with little to no spoilers and how we felt over all about the book. Along with a spoiler-y discussion about the book for people who have/will read the book. The spoiler-y discussion is hidden from view and is only accessible upon purposefully highlighting the invisible text. In the spoiler-y discussion we mention what we couldn’t before without giving something away. Love interests, main events, surprise plot twists, emotions at certain points, etc., may be mentioned in this part of the post.



It is not often that we do not finish a book but if that occurs we will try to say a few nice things about the book but basically a “not a book for me” kind of thing. Others might enjoy it so we will encourage them to check other reviews on Goodreads (and the overall ratings listed on that website)

Our rating System
6 Star *SPECIAL* - This is now one of my ALL TIME FAVORITE books, you MUST get this book SOMEHOW. This is the difference between life and death. **NOTICE** this book may cause EXTREME fangirling. READ AGAIN AND AGAIN!

5 Star- This book is EXTREMELY AMAZING and a must read. It is everything a good book should be. Definitely worth reading (and purchasing) MUST READ AGAIN.

4 Star- AMAZING book! So good! Caught my attention and held it. It's not a five because there were some things in this book that really annoyed me and I wish were different.

3 Star- Good quick read that is good to pass the time, not really something I would read twice, but I was interested when I read it.

2 Star- Did not catch my attention, it was slow and boring in some or most parts. Don't necessarily recommend but it is not the worst book.

1 Star- Could not even finish reading. It was poorly written or boring. Content was not my personal preference and I do not recommend this book.

*** incriments of .5 are used on some occasions. (for when the book is both descirptions)***
